President Trump vetoed the FY2021 National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A).
The bill passed the House and Senate, but whether or not Congress will override this harmful veto is still unknown. The House is expected to try on Monday.
Trump’s arguments are that this legislation requires military installations named in honor of Confederate soldiers to be renamed, and Section 230 of the Communications Decency Act, which protects Internet companies from liability for content posted by third parties.
